Overall I'm whelmed with this dresser. I was disappointed with the quality. I didn't expect much for the price, and got it. It's at or below Wal-Mart level and feels very cheap. The drawer slides are actually plastic. The veneer doesn't go the edges, so the corners are of a different color than the surfaces. Unlike the larger dresser, this doesn't have a brown marker for filling in this problem. The whole thing generally feels very loose and cheap. The Amazon picture makes it look MUCH better than it actually is.
I ordered two of them and they were different. Same end result, but completely different layouts and underlying parts. One of them was missing holes, which I drilled myself, and the other came with no nails, which I luckily had on hand.
That being said, it gets the job done. Nothing was broken, it went together in about 30 minutes, and it is now holding clothes. So it does what it's meant to do, but it's not very pretty while doing it.
